Position: Cook I (Hampshire DC)

Overview

Prepares and cooks food such as meat, fish, poultry, sauces, gravies, soup, and other foods in large-scale quantities; evaluates food for quality, quantity, appearance, temperature, and taste. Acts as a station champion, leading a small team and performing routine tasks in preparing and serving food to order. Trains kitchen staff as needed.

Responsibilities
  • Prepares food items according to recipe and standard operating procedure to fill customer orders in a timely fashion, adjusting recipes as needed.
  • Accountable for timely opening, prep sheets and inventory levels, preparation of ingredients to par levels, consistent preparation of finished product to recipe standards, and overall sanitation of a food station.
  • Assigns staff to positions within the station as necessary for maximum efficiency.
  • Interacts with customers regarding any questions, comments or complaints.
  • Cleans food preparation areas using standard procedures to maintain safety and sanitation standards.
  • Monitors the quality, quantity and timeliness of food served to maintain quality control and consistency of product served.
  • Monitors the flow of business by checking the number of customers in line and adjusting food preparation procedures or requesting additional help as necessary.
  • Assists employees of higher grades in preparation of more complex dishes, i.e., soups, sauces, gravies; may prepare dishes that are more complex by using standard recipes and computerized recipes.
  • Evaluates food for quality, quantity, appearance, temperature, and taste by tasting and observing to determine proper freshness, preparation, and portioning.
  • Stores food in sanitary storage areas and at proper temperature to prevent spoilage.
  • Communicates with Cook III and supervisors to report food and menu problems.
  • Reads and uses computer generated standard menus and recipes to prepare meals.
Qualifications
  • At least one (1) year of full-time or equivalent part-time experience in the preparation and cooking of food.
  • Incumbents must be certified as food handlers within six months of the appointment start date through a recognized program approved by the University of Massachusetts (i.e. Serv Safe).
  • Knowledge of the standard methods and techniques used in food handling, storage, preparation, cooking and serving of food in large quantities.
  • Ability to train staff on the types and uses of utensils and equipment used in large quantity food preparation and cooking.
  • Ability to supervise, including planning and assigning work according to the nature of the job to be accomplished.
  • Physical and stamina requirements captured in the Physical Demands section.
Physical Demands
  • Requires balance, carry, push, pull, stand, bend, reach, twist, lift, and perform repetitive movements.
  • Ability and stamina to perform manual tasks including standing for long periods, lifting, and carrying heavy objects, and working under conditions of seasonal high and low temperatures.
  • Exposure to hazards of wet and slippery floors, seasonal high and low temperatures, and sharp surfaces.
Work Schedule

40 hours per week; 8am-4pm, rotating weekends; may include holidays. Minimum 35 weeks.

Salary

AFSCME Non-Exempt Grade 10. Classified Step Scale.
